There are a number of clubs in the Premier League who are needing to sell some of their players this month ahead of the 30 June PSR deadline.

Tottenham are not one of those sides, however, they do have a number of players who Postecoglou would be willing to offload having had a year now to assess his inherited squad.

Some players have already left the club having been released following the end of their contracts like Ryan Sessegnon and Ivan Perisic.

Giovani Lo Celso is one of the players who could join them in leaving Spurs this summer with interest building for his signature.

It is believed Aston Villa are even one of the clubs who are showing an interest in signing Lo Celso this summer.

And Spurs’ vice-captain, Romero, has now issued a message of support to Lo Celso following his recent display for Argentina.

Replying to Lo Celso’s Instagram post after their recent win over Ecuador, Romero said: “You make everything alright”.

Despite Romero’s glowing review of his compatriot, it does seem as if his opportunities at Spurs are gone with Postecoglou using him sparingly over the 2023/24 campaign.

What Lionel Messi has said about Giovani Lo Celso

Despite not playing regularly for Tottenham, the £70k-per-week Lo Celso remains a frequent feature in the Argentina side during the international breaks.

And he has received some glowing reviews from the likes of Lionel Messi who wished he was with the Argentina squad during their World Cup triumph.

“We miss you and Gio [Lo Celso], you two are always present!” Messi said to Sergio Aguero during the tournament in 2022.

Clearly, this is a player who is rated extremely highly by some of the best to ever do it on a football pitch, but Postecoglou – like other Spurs managers – evidently does not see it.
